Output 86a73c2fee82001b56062fd52fcb150acf19eed2bddf46ef7901eef8b23df1b4:145

value
293960
script pubkey
OP_0 OP_PUSHBYTES_20 e8aaf4832754166000a7ee35cc9d03c6b985f6a9
address
bc1qaz40fqe82stxqq98ac6ue8grc6ucta4fsd6g4d
transaction
86a73c2fee82001b56062fd52fcb150acf19eed2bddf46ef7901eef8b23df1b4
spent
true